Pineapple Express auto - Amsterdam Marijuana Seeds AMS
Pineapple Express from AMS was started in a 1 liter air pot and moved to a 5 gallon fabric pot filled with a living soil mix at around day 14.
She was topdressed with a half cup of End Game Flowering Mix at the end of week four and again 3 weeks later.
About every third week I gave her a drink of compost tea.
She was harvested on day 92 . At harvest she was 24" tall and about 15" in diameter.
I removed 784g wet .
After drying and curing for about six weeks yield was 78.5g / 2.8oz
All colas were quite fat.
Trimming before hanging to dry was time consuming .
Final trim before jarring was a pain in the ass. The buds had opened up considerably during drying revealing lots of leafs and tons of nanners that needed to be removed. (None of the other strains in this grow had any issues with nanners) It is possibly just a fluke but I won't be able to know on account of 4 out of 5 seeds failed to germinate.
I will probably not be running this one again anytime soon.
